Игорь
Frontend-розробник, 100 000 грн
Контактная информация
Соискатель указал телефон и эл. почту.
Фамилия, контакты и фото доступны только для зарегистрированных работодателей. Чтобы получить доступ к личным данным кандидатов, войдите как работодатель или зарегистрируйтесь.
Получить контакты этого кандидата можно на странице https://www.work.ua/resumes/3484733/
Опыт работы
Front-end разработчик
с 04.2021 по 12.2025
(4 года 9 месяцев)
Makeup, Київ (Роздрібна торгівля)
Основные задачи:
- руководство командой
- разработка и реализация веб-приложений компании
Front-end разработчик
с 05.2019 по 04.2021
(2 года)
PartsTech, Київ (IT)
Основные задачи:
- работа над продуктом компании
- редизайн legacy-интерфейсов
- рефакторинг legacy-компонентов и legacy-интерфейсов
Основные инструменты и технологии: React, React Router, React Hooks, Redux, Redux Thunk, StoryBook, TypeScript, JS, SCSS, Emotion (CSS-in-JS), Jira, ESLint
Front-end разработчик
с 09.2018 по 04.2019
(8 месяцев)
Ning, Київ (IT)
Основные инструменты и технологии: React, Redux, Redux Thunk, Ramda, JS, JSS (CSS-in-JS), Jira, Scrum
Руководитель команды
с 02.2017 по 09.2018
(1 год 8 месяцев)
FOZZY GROUP, Київ (Розничная торговля)
Основные задачи:
- руководство командой
- разработка и реализация веб-приложений компании
Основные инструменты и технологии: Agile, Jira, React, Flux, JS, HTML5, CSS3, Git,
Front-end разработчик
с 08.2016 по 02.2017
(7 месяцев)
FOZZY GROUP, Київ (Розничная торговля)
Основные задачи:
- разработка и реализация веб-приложений компании
- создание единой библиотеки компонентов для веб-приложений
Основные инструменты и технологии: React, Flux, JS, HTML5, CSS3, Git,
Frontend-разработчик
с 02.2016 по 08.2016
(7 месяцев)
My Jet, Дистанційно (IT)
Основные задачи:
- разработка и реализация веб-приложения для клиентов компании
В рамках работы был создан и запущен сайт для клиентов компании, на котором они могли видеть полную информацию о своих самолетах
Основные инструменты и технологии: React, HTML + HTML5, CSS + CSS3.
Front-end разработчик
с 01.2014 по 11.2014
(11 месяцев)
Йополис, Дистанційно (IT)
Основные задачи:
- разработка и реализация клиентской части проекта
- рефакторинг кода, code review кода коллег
- верстка макетов для проекта
Основные инструменты и технологии: TWIG как серверный шаблонизатор, нативный JS, jQuery, HTML + HTML5, CSS + CSS3, Git, БЭМ, Closure Linter.
Работу в компании начал с позиции front-end разработчика и, после обучения стажера до уровня middle front-end, перешел на позицию senior front-end.
Во время работы мною были реализованы SPA (только front-end часть):
- Геотеги
- Бизнес-профиль:
1) рефакторинг и доработка страницы создания
2) создание SPA бизнес-профиляc inline-редактированием большей части блоков (что упростило и редактирование, а так же позволило редактировать профили без админ панели)
3) лэндинг бизнес-профиля
Так же была мной написана новая многошаговая форма авторизаци, которая расширила возможности пользователя при регистрации и авторизации
Так же, совместно с руководителем направления было введено code review на площадке Crucible. Активно принимал участие в решении архитектурных вопросах проекта и процессах разработки.
Front-end разработчик
с 08.2012 по 12.2013
(1 год 5 месяцев)
HeadHunter, Дистанційно (IT)
Основные задачи:
- разработка и реализация клиентской части проектов, входящих в группу сайтов hh.ua (а также сервисов)
- разработка контроллеров на Python, также реализация бизнес-логики на Python
- рефакторинг кода, code review кода коллег
- верстка макетов для проектов и сервисов
Основные инструменты и технологии: нативный JS, jQuery, XSLT, HTML + HTML5, CSS + CSS3, Git, Python, БЭМ.
Познакомился со Scrum, как методологией управления процессом разработки
Front-end разработчик
с 05.2011 по 08.2012
(1 год 4 месяца)
BigBuzzy, Дистанційно (IT)
Основные задачи:
- разработка новых функциональных решиний для проекта и их дальнейшая реализация (разработал привязку платиновых карт оплаты к сервису с использованием кроссдоменных AJAX-запросов, несколько плагинов, среди которых "Блок баннеров на главной странице" с возможностью гибкой настройки (по городам, пользователям, сроком жизни и показа баннра и т. д.)
- рефакторинг существуещего кода, code review кода коллег по отделу
- валидная и кроссбраузерная верстка макетов и отдельных функциональных блоков (модулей)
- обслуживание почтового сервиса проекта, а именно: создание новых шаблонов писем, оптимизация более старых, доработка существующих шаблонов. Использовал freemarker, как шаблонизатор для писем
- сборка релизов и деплой на продакш-сервер
Основные технологии и языки, используемые на проекте:
- нативный JavaScript, jQuery для написания клиентской программной части.
XSLT, FreeMarker - как языки-шаблонизаторы (языки преобразования).
HTML + HTML5, CSS + CSS3 для валибной семантической кроссбраузерной верстки.
Git - как основная систему управления проектом.
Также иногда использовались библиотеки Underscore-Backbone, Handlebars, EasyXDM, Modernizr
Образование
МГПУ
Информатики-математики, Мелитополь
Высшее, с 2004 по 2009 (5 лет)
Знания и навыки
- JavaScript
- React
- Верстка
- SASS
- TypeScript
- Bootstrap
- Redux
- HTML
- JQuery
- Webpack
- Figma
- CSS
- Git
- GitHub
- Next.js
- React Router
- React Hooks
- REST API
- React Query
- React Hook Form
- React Redux
Знание языков
- Английский — начинающий
- Украинский — свободно
Дополнительная информация
- JS, jQuery, MVC,
- XSLT, FreeMarker,
- HTML + HTML5,
- CSS + CSS3,
- Git
- Underscore, Mustache, Handlebars,
- Scrum
- Polymer
- Gulp
- Npm
- ES6
- React
- Redux
- Redux Thunk
- Redux Middleware
- React Hooks
- CSS-in-JS (JSS, Emotion)
- StoryBook
- TypeScript
Похожие кандидаты
-
Junior Front End Developer
Киев -
Front-end програміст
25000 грн, Киев -
Front-end програміст
Запорожье, Удаленно -
Front-end програміст
Киев, Винница , еще 6 городов -
Front-end програміст
99000 грн, Киев -
Middle Front-end Developer (Next.js, TypeScript)
Удаленно